Technical field
This utility model is related to connector construction field, particularly to a kind of double nip of resistance to environment USB3.0 adapter.
Background technology
Avionics system high frequency USB3.0 communication signal transmits.General electric connector is low frequency signal adapter, meets
Military electric connector respective standard, civil telecommunications science and technology fast development in recent years, product and constantly being lifted with communication interface performance,
Common interfaces upgrade to USB3.0 by USB2.0, and transfer rate upgrades to 5Gbps by original 480Mbps, rises to USB2.0
10 times of transfer rate, military electric connector is mostly low-frequency electric connector although environmental resistance is excellent, but cannot meet height
Fast transmission requirement, certain avionic device needs this type electric connector to possess excellent environmental resistance, can transmit height simultaneously
Fast USB3.0 signal, can facilitate simultaneously and directly be connected with USB3.0 storage or reading equipment on machine.This double nip of resistance to environment
USB3.0 connector plug can dock use with socket, and the printed board that socket tail end exposes can identify welding USB3.0 line by hole position
Cable, socket also can be used alone on the installation panel of avionics system or equipment, when needed with USB3.0 storage or reading
Taking equipment connects.
Utility model content
The purpose of this utility model is an up normal domestic USB3.0 interface environmental resistance, so that USB3.0 interface can be applied
In avionics system, spy provides a kind of double nip of resistance to environment USB3.0 adapter.
This utility model provide a kind of double nip of resistance to environment USB3.0 adapter it is characterised in that:Described resistance to environment
Double nip USB3.0 adapter, including the double nip of resistance to environment USB3.0 socket 1, the double nip of resistance to environment USB3.0 plug 2;
The double nip of resistance to environment USB3.0 socket 1 is by square plate housing 101, pre-positioning block 102, sealing ring 103, post-positioning block
104th, back-up ring 105, rubber blanket 106, USB3.0 twoport female seat 107, printed wiring board 108 form;
The USB3.0 of resistance to environment plug 2 is by housing 201, coupling nut 202, spring detent 203, rivet 204, shading ring 205, a left side
Position fast 206, right locating piece 207, USB3.0 male cable 208, doubling-up jump ring 209 form;
Wherein:USB3.0 twoport female seat 107 is passed through printed wiring board 108 and is lengthened switching, constitutes welding module, convenient follow-up
Wiring;Power line and holding wire hierarchical design are realized on printed wiring board 108, it is to avoid disturb each other, differential pair signal line leads to
Cross designing impedance matching and ensure impedance matching in product circuit, to meet the integrity of high-speed signal transmission;Welding module passes through
Pre-positioning block 102, post-positioning block 104 and back-up ring 105 are fixed in square plate housing 101, load sealing ring in square plate housing 101
103 sealing functions realizing socket 1 and plug 2 butt-joint clearance, realize product moisture proof function, between square plate housing 101 and plug 2
Connected by three-start screw and can achieve that product quickly connects;
It is fixing with coupling nut 202 that the spring detent 203 of plug passes through rivet 204, the projection that spring detent 203 stamps out with
Housing 201 outer ring key teeth cooperation, may be implemented in plug 2 under the environment such as vibration, impact, being reliably connected of socket 1;Doubling-up jump ring
209 by spacing for coupling nut 202 on housing 201;USB3.0 male cable 208 is limited by left locating piece 206, right locating piece 207
Position is to inside housing 201.
Described plug 2 is to dock use with socket 1, and the printed board that socket 1 tail end exposes can identify welding by hole position
USB3.0 cable, socket 1 also can be used alone on the installation panel of avionics system or equipment, when needed with USB3.0
Storage or the equipment that reads connect.
Advantage of the present utility model:
The double nip of resistance to environment USB3.0 adapter described in the utility model, substantially increases environmental resistance poor
The environmental resistance of USB3.0 interface, can be applicable in the severe avionics system of use environment or equipment, passes for transmission
Defeated speed is up to the USB3.0 signal of 5.0Gbps.Product is easy to use, can quickly connect or discrete it is not necessary to additionally be protected
Danger processes and also can ensure to be reliably connected, and the over-all properties of generic USB 3.0 interface has been fully retained.
